Overview

The Senior Manager- Facility Maintenance oversees all aspects of facility maintenance, building operations, and asset management to ensure a safe, efficient, and reliable work environment. This role leads a team of maintenance professionals, manages preventive and corrective maintenance programs, coordinates capital projects, and ensures compliance with safety and regulatory standards. The ideal candidate is a strategic leader with hands-on technical expertise and strong organizational skills.

Responsibilities

Leadership & Strategy

  • Lead, mentor, and develop a team of maintenance technicians, supervisors, and contractors.
  • Develop and execute facility maintenance strategies aligned with organizational goals.
  • Oversee budgeting, forecasting, and resource allocation for maintenance operations.

Maintenance Operations

  • Manage preventive and predictive maintenance programs for all building systems, including HVAC, electrical, plumbing, fire safety, security, and structural components.
  • Oversee work order systems and ensure timely completion of maintenance requests.
  • Coordinate major repairs, renovations, and capital improvement projects.

Compliance & Safety

  • Ensure compliance with OSHA, ADA, EPA, and other relevant safety and environmental regulations.
  • Maintain accurate documentation of inspections, permits, and certifications.
  • Promote a strong safety culture through training and regular audits.

Vendor & Contract Management

  • Negotiate and manage service contracts with external vendors and suppliers.
  • Monitor contractor performance, ensuring work meets quality and safety standards.

Sustainability & Cost Efficiency

  • Identify opportunities to improve energy efficiency and reduce operational costs.
  • Recommend and implement sustainable facility initiatives.

Emergency Response

  • Develop and maintain emergency preparedness and business continuity plans.
  • Act as a key point of contact during critical incidents affecting facilities.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Facilities Management, Engineering, Construction Management, or a related field (or equivalent experience).
  • 7–10 years of progressive experience in facilities maintenance, with at least 3 years in a leadership role.
  • Strong knowledge of building systems, maintenance best practices, and regulatory compliance.
  • Proven ability to manage budgets and capital projects.
  • Excellent leadership, communication, and problem-solving skills.
  • Proficiency in CMMS (Computerized Maintenance Management Systems).
  • Professional certifications such as CFM, FMP, PMP, or equivalent are preferred.

WORKING CONDITIONS / EDUCATION / EXPERIENCE


Working Conditions: Entire facility: office environment and manufacturing environment.


Physical Demands:

  • Ability to walk, stand, and inspect building interiors/exteriors regularly.
  • May occasionally lift up to 50 lbs and climb ladders or access equipment areas.
  • Ability to respond to facility emergencies outside regular business hours.
